Fellow passengers were very friendly and the staff catered to our every need as if we were the only ones on the boat. The tours were run amazingly well considering the combined logistics of boats buses and hydrofoils connecting with each other seamlessly. There was little waiting or downtime. The tour guides were energetic entertaining and informative. They knew their stuff and enjoyed imparting their wisdom. The ship was immaculate and maintained fastidiously . The same can be said for the buses. The food on the ship was wonderful and without limitation. The coffee was not particularly to my taste but I guess you can’t have everything . I indulged on the steaks of which I truly enjoyed. On final departure we were surprised and delighted by members of the Viking staff walking us through the check in at the Copenhagen airport turning what is sometimes a confusing experience into a pleasant one. Its details like this that want to make sail with Viking again. To be totally honest l have to offer one small criticism - the maps of the ports of call issued by the concierge were pretty useless but we always managed to find a good one in the respective towns. All in all it was a great trip.
